Transaction 667feba9892ac05071fd2f1de752b8a44e102407a74bf2c2155bb69c11ca260a

3 Input
2 Outputs
  • 667feba9892ac05071fd2f1de752b8a44e102407a74bf2c2155bb69c11ca260a:0
  • value  991007
    address  3BZL8PioxhokBzvKZSeFnvWyFzXySLFnto
  • 667feba9892ac05071fd2f1de752b8a44e102407a74bf2c2155bb69c11ca260a:1
  • value  248283
    address  17ZDkd5QCjQ1E7gDzT8BhbJhbbyfEDNezd